Title edit
American Road & Transportation Builders Association (ARTBA)
Description edit
Behind the headlines of today's high-tech and high-flying industries-from satellite communications and e-commerce to CAT scanning and microsurgery-runs a dependable, unifying reality. No matter how sophisticated or elaborate their products or services, every enterprise in America depends upon the nation's infrastructure of highways, airports and public transportation. And, although in our busy lives we largely take its prodigious benefits for granted, this transportation system not only ensures America's economic prosperity, but each day contributes vitally to the success of every facet of our national and local community life.
The bare facts of the system reveal its importance: almost four million miles of public roads; 5,415 airports; 6,185 miles of urban transit; 200,000 miles of freight and passenger railway; and 3,750 waterport terminals. A recent government estimate values the nation's roads, bridges, airports and mass transit facilities in excess of $1.5 trillion. But the system's operating dynamics are more compelling still, for not only is the network continually expanding to meet growing transportation needs, it must also be constantly maintained and renewed. U.S. transportation construction is a $200 billion-per-year industry, a greater proportion of the gross domestic product than farming, petroleum, motion pictures, or tobacco. Not surprisingly, so vast a system embraces diverse disciplines, resources and skills in countless communities, and a great many companies large and small whose common interests are vitally affected by federal, state, and local legislatures and judiciaries. For the last century, those common interests of the transportation construction industry have been actively coordinated, pursued and advocated by an uncommonly energetic trade group, the American Road and Transportation Builders Association (ARTBA).
